In today’s data‑driven landscape, the ability to permanently erase confidential information is a non‑negotiable requirement for both individuals and organizations. Conventional deletion merely removes directory entries, leaving raw data intact on the storage medium where it can be reconstructed with forensic tools. This utility addresses that gap by overwriting the underlying sectors with multiple passes, adhering to globally recognized sanitization standards, and guaranteeing that the erased content cannot be recovered.

Handling Modern Storage Media

Solid‑state drives (SSDs) store data differently from traditional spinning disks, rendering conventional multi‑pass overwriting both inefficient and potentially harmful to drive longevity. The software automatically detects SSDs and switches to a TRIM‑based approach, signaling the drive’s firmware to purge the targeted blocks securely. This method respects the wear‑leveling algorithms inherent to SSDs while still achieving a level of data sanitization comparable to overwriting on HDDs.

For hybrid environments that contain both HDDs and SSDs, the tool intelligently applies the appropriate technique to each volume, eliminating the need for manual configuration. Users can also force a traditional overwrite on an SSD if required by a specific compliance rule, though the default TRIM strategy is recommended for optimal performance and hardware preservation.
